Indulge in the captivating world of “Maigret Enjoys Himself” by Georges Simenon. Follow the astute Inspector Maigret as he unravels a perplexing case in the charming French countryside. With keen observation and brilliant deduction, Maigret navigates through a web of secrets, lies, and hidden motives to uncover the truth. Experience the allure of classic detective fiction.
